Win a trip to Google HQ, Android phones with cyber wellness contest

Alfred Siew
Last updated: June 13, 2014 at 4:44 PM
Alfred Siew
Published: August 6, 2012
1 Min Read

Here’s a contest that is actually a little meaningful and also has some rather attractive prizes for Singapore’s young online surfers.

How would you like to travel to Google’s headquarters at Mountain View, California or win some brand new Android phones? What you need to do is create a video that brings up issues to do with cyber wellness and stand out against the many dozens other entries.

Put together by Google and the Media Development Authority (MDA), the contest is open to youths between 13 and 19 years old.

The grand prize of a trip to Google in the United States is an all-expenses-paid one consisting of four days, three nights. The team that finishes as the first runner up will get Android phones for each member of the group.

Submissions are open from now until September 30. Judges from Google and MDA will review the entries and pick the winners by October 16.
